- Added detection of unclosed tags (tags without begin/end). - Added recovery of potentially unclosed tags. - Added detection of invalid structure tags (tags that do not end with '>'). - Modified detection of bad attribute values to be parse errors instead of runtime errors. - Modified RazorParser to sort errors. This made writing tests more intuitive and ultimately ensures that the editor shows errors in the correct order. - Added tests to validate invalid tag structure. - Added tests to validate invalid attributes. - Added tests to validate unclosed tags. #104 |
||
|---|---|---|
| .. | ||
| Editor | ||
| Framework | ||
| Generator | ||
| Parser | ||
| TagHelpers | ||
| TestFiles | ||
| Text | ||
| Tokenizer | ||
| Utils | ||
| CSharpRazorCodeLanguageTest.cs | ||
| Microsoft.AspNet.Razor.Test.kproj | ||
| RazorCodeLanguageTest.cs | ||
| RazorDirectiveAttributeTest.cs | ||
| RazorEngineHostTest.cs | ||
| RazorTemplateEngineTest.cs | ||
| StringTextBuffer.cs | ||
| project.json | ||